#294 - Navigating Privileged Access Management with Michiel Stoop
#294 - Navigating Privileged Access Management with Michiel Stoop

In this episode of the 'Identity at the Center' podcast, Jeff and Jim discuss the complexities of managing Privileged Access Management (PAM) and the challenges of balancing various responsibilities like real jobs, podcasting, and attending conferences. They highlight upcoming conferences like Identity Week America and the Authenticate conference, offering discount codes for listeners. The main guest, Michiel Stoop, Director of Identity Management at Philips, shares insights on the importance of PAM, the process of selling PAM initiatives to management, and the integration of technology in identity and access management. The episode also covers methodologies for selecting the right PAM products and strategies for minimizing attack surfaces. To end on a lighter note, the hosts discuss must-try activities and foods in the Netherlands.
